The Drew Hamilton Early Childhood Program provides children ages 2½-5 with an enriching curriculum in a nurturing environment. The full-day program includes excellent teachers, age-appropriate lessons, fun trips, recreation and rest time, as well as two healthy meals and a snack. The children attend from 8 a.m. until 5:45 p.m.

  • Year-round full-day care/Head Start collaboration
  • Fun learning environment for children
  • Free Universal Pre-K (UPK)
  • Exciting, age-appropriate trips
  • Neighborhood walks to familiarize the children with important people and places in their environment
  • Talented story tellers and puppeteers visit our children
  • Regular visits from the dental van to check the children’s oral hygiene as well as clean their teeth.
  • Children daily brush their teeth after meals.
  • Jump For Joy dance instruction to promote good health through yoga, movement and aerobics
